Additional Hospital Information & Who We are Looking For:
We are seeking an experienced veterinarian to join the team in a Medical Lead role. This position combines hands-on clinical practice with medical leadership responsibilities, guiding clinical standards, supporting complex case direction, and contributing to quality of care initiatives across the hospital. Prior leadership experience is a bonus but not required — what matters most is strong clinical judgment, collaborative communication, and a passion for excellent medicine.
- Supportive, Experienced Technical & Clinical Staff: Join a dedicated team focused on delivering comprehensive, compassionate care. Support staff collaborate closely with doctors in diagnostics, surgery, anesthesia, treatments, and client communication, creating an environment where medical leadership can flourish while providing high-quality patient care.
- Layout Specifics: Full-service facility offering multiple exam and treatment areas, surgical and dental suites, advanced diagnostics and testing equipment, and urgent care capabilities designed to support both excellent general practice medicine and leadership in clinical protocols and outcomes.
- Collaborative Leadership Environment: The Medical Lead will partner with hospital management to enhance clinical workflows, standardize best practices, review and refine medical protocols, and act as a key voice for medical quality and consistency across the team.
- Patient Mix: A varied caseload primarily focused on dogs and cats across wellness, preventive, surgical, urgent, and advanced care visits, offering the opportunity to practice broad-scope medicine and influence clinical direction in a dynamic practice setting.
Medical Lead Role Snapshot
Clinical Responsibilities (80–90%)
- Provide high-quality small-animal medicine across a full spectrum of general practice, surgical, and urgent/advanced care cases
- Communicate clearly and compassionately with clients about diagnostics, recommendations, and outcomes
- Lead by example in medical decision-making, professionalism, and client communication on the floor
Medical Lead / Leader of Medicine Responsibilities (10–20%)
- Guide clinical standards and protocols across the hospital, ensuring consistency and quality of care
- Serve as a clinical resource for the doctor team on complex cases and medical decisions
- Partner with hospital leadership to evaluate and refine workflows, best practices, and clinical outcomes
- Promote a culture of medical excellence, accountability, and continuous improvement within the team
